Castle Employment Group is seeking an experienced tax professional for a hybrid role in East Yorkshire. You will own indirect tax processes and support wider finance initiatives, ensuring compliance in a growing international business.
The position offers a competitive salary of approximately £65,000, opportunities for progression, and the chance to influence strategic projects while working collaboratively with a finance team.
The role entails regular exposure to senior stakeholders and a proactive approach to adding value in a complex environment.
